St. Sylvester's athlete Asardeen three 'firsts' in dual meet in
Chennai
by Upananda JAYASUNDERA - Kandy Sports Special Corr.
ATHLETICS: Three events - three firsts. That was the proud
achievement of St. Sylvester's College, Kandy athlete H.A.M. Asardeen in
the Dual Athletic Meet between Sri Lanka and Tamil Nadu at the Nehru
Stadium in Chennai between 19th to 24th December 2011. Asardeen running
in the under 14 age group for boys, came first in the 100 metres in 12.3
seconds, 200 metres again first in 25.5 seconds and first in the Long
Jump with a distance of 5.42 metres.
Asardeen is a Year 10 student of St. Sylvester's College, Kandy and
is a talented athlete with a bright future. He qualified to run in the
meet in Chennai when he won all three events at the Junior Athletic Meet
of Lanka Lions Sports Club held early last year.
